VVIX, then, can indicate when VIX isn’t very volatile, and so isn’t foreseeing much volatility in SPX. This can happen when VIX is relatively low—under or around 15, for example. Alternatively, a high VVIX suggests VIX might be more volatile in the future, which in turn can indicate a market belief that SPX might also be more volatile.

The Cboe Volatility Index, or VIX, edged up in trading Tuesday after closing at its lowest level since January ...Trade 2: Buy VIX Futures in Backwardation. The opposite of the short volatility trade exhibited above is buying VIX Futures when they are in backwardation. This anticipates that the futures will increase in price as they get closer to expiration, as long as the VIX Index itself remains elevated.
